When i purchased my j plate is came on a dechoked carb, the previous owner had removed the flap that opens/closes when the choke is engadged and dis engadged, and filled the hole. The car amazingly stills starts etc in most conditions easy enough but im just wondering does it actually offer any benefit?

Sy5GTT
07-12-2009, 09:15
I de-choked mine but left the cable and cam. This means you can still increase the revs but not richen up when cold. I don't think it makes alot of difference but it's something thats out of the way of the flow.
